This document discusses ethics and principles of communication. It defines ethics as a system of moral principles dealing with right and wrong human conduct and values. Communication ethics are the principles governing communication, including what is right or wrong and moral vs immoral aspects. Unethical communication threatens the well-being of individuals and society. The principles of ethical communication are to advocate for truth, accuracy, honesty, freedom of expression, and condemning communication that degrades or intimidates. People should also be responsible for the consequences of their communication.

COMMUNICATION COMMUNICATION ETHICS AND PRINCIPLES LESSON 4 ETHICS
• A system of moral principles
• It deals with values relating to human conduct, with respect to the rightness and wrongness of certain actions and to the goodness and badness of the motives and ends of such actions. COMMUNICATION ETHICS
• The principle governing communication, the right and wrong
aspects of it, the moral-immoral dimensions relevant to comunication. UNETHICAL COMMUNICATION
• Threatens the quality of all communication and consequently
the well-being of individuals and the society. PRINCIPLES OF ETHICAL COMMUNICATION • 1. advocate truthfulness, accuracy, honesty and reason as essential to the integrity of communication. PRINCIPLES OF ETHICAL COMMUNICATION • 2. endorse freedom of expression, diversity of perspective, and tolerance of dissent to achieve the informed and responsible decision making fundamental to a civil society PRINCIPLES OF ETHICAL COMMUNICATION • 3. condemn communication that degrades individuals and humanity through distortion, intimidation, coercion and violence, and through the expression of intolerance and hatred PRINCIPLES OF ETHICAL COMMUNICATION • 4. accept responsibility for the short- and long- term consequences for our own communication and expect the same of others.
